web前端都有什么
-
Web前端指的是负责对用户界面进行设计和开发的技术人员。他们主要负责使用HTML、CSS和JavaScript等前端技术来实现网页的布局、样式和交互效果。以下是一些常见的Web前端技术和工具。
-
HTML:超文本标记语言,用于构建网页结构和内容。
-
CSS:层叠样式表,用于设置网页的样式和布局,如字体、颜色、边距等。
-
JavaScript:一种高级编程语言,用于实现网页的交互功能,如表单验证、动态加载内容等。
-
jQuery:一个JavaScript库,简化了对HTML文档的操作和事件处理。
-
Bootstrap:一个流行的前端框架,提供了一套用于快速设计响应式网页的CSS和JavaScript组件。
-
AngularJS:一种JavaScript框架,用于构建单页应用程序(SPA)和实现MVC(模型-视图-控制器)模式。
-
Vue.js:一种轻量级的JavaScript框架,用于构建用户界面和单页应用程序。
-
React:由Facebook开发的JavaScript库,用于构建用户界面和组件化开发。
-
Sass/LESS:CSS预处理器,提供了变量、嵌套规则、混合等功能,使得CSS编写更加高效和易于维护。
-
Gulp/Grunt:自动化构建工具,用于优化和自动化前端开发流程,如压缩、合并、编译等。
-
Git:版本控制系统,用于管理和跟踪项目代码的变化。
-
Photoshop:图像处理软件,用于设计和处理网页中的图像和界面元素。
-
Chrome开发者工具:浏览器内置的一组工具,用于调试和分析网页的性能和布局。
这只是一部分常见的Web前端技术和工具,随着技术的不断发展,前端领域也在不断变化和更新。同时,Web前端开发也需要不断学习和掌握新的技术来适应市场需求。
1年前 -
-
Web前端是指负责将网页设计变成可被浏览器读取和显示的代码和界面的开发人员。他们使用HTML、CSS和JavaScript等技术来创建并优化网页的外观和功能。以下是Web前端开发中常用的技术和工具:
-
HTML:超文本标记语言是Web页面的基础,用于描述页面的结构和内容。开发人员使用HTML标签来创建网页的各个元素,如标题、段落、图像、表格等。
-
CSS:层叠样式表用于控制网页的外观和布局。开发人员使用CSS来设置字体、颜色、背景、间距等样式,以及创建响应式设计和动画效果。
-
JavaScript:作为一种脚本语言,JavaScript用于与用户进行交互并实现网页的动态功能。开发人员使用JavaScript来验证表单、处理用户输入、加载数据、创建动态效果等。
-
前端框架:前端框架是一组预定义的代码和库,用于加速开发过程和提供更好的用户体验。例如,React、Angular和Vue.js是常用的JavaScript框架,它们提供了组件化开发、虚拟DOM等特性。
-
CSS预处理器:CSS预处理器(如Sass和Less)允许开发人员使用类似编程语言的语法来编写CSS代码。预处理器将代码编译成普通的CSS,使得样式的管理更加高效和易于维护。
-
前端构建工具:像Webpack和Gulp这样的构建工具可以优化和打包前端资源,如合并和压缩CSS和JavaScript文件,缓存管理以及自动化任务。
-
浏览器开发者工具:现代浏览器都提供了开发者工具,开发人员可以使用这些工具来调试和优化网页。例如,检查元素、监视网络请求、性能分析等。
-
响应式设计:开发人员需要确保网页能够适应不同设备和屏幕尺寸,以提供一致的用户体验。使用媒体查询和流式布局等技术可以实现响应式设计。
-
版本控制工具:版本控制工具(如Git)允许开发人员管理和跟踪代码的变化。通过版本控制,团队成员可以合作开发、撤销修改和解决代码冲突。
-
页面性能优化:为了提供更好的用户体验,开发人员需要优化网页的加载速度和性能。他们可以压缩和缓存静态资源、使用图片优化技术、减少HTTP请求等来提高性能。
总而言之,Web前端开发涉及许多技术和工具,开发人员需要掌握HTML、CSS和JavaScript等基础知识,并熟悉一些常用的前端框架和工具来创建优秀的网页界面。
1年前 -
-
Web前端开发是指开发Web页面的技术,主要负责网站的前端交互和界面呈现。Web前端开发涉及到HTML、CSS和JavaScript等技术。下面将分别介绍这些技术。
一、HTML(HyperText Markup Language)
HTML是一种标记语言,用于描述网页的结构。通过使用HTML标签和属性,可以创建页面的各种元素,如标题、段落、图像、链接等。
HTML包含以下常用标签:
- 标题标签:
<h1>~<h6> - 段落标签:
<p> - 图像标签:
<img> - 链接标签:
<a> - 表格标签:
<table> - 列表标签:
<ul>、<ol>、<li> - 表单标签:
<form>、<input>、<button>等
二、CSS(Cascading Style Sheets)
CSS是一种样式表语言,用于控制网页的布局和外观。通过使用CSS选择器和属性,可以定义页面元素的样式。
CSS包含以下常用属性:
- 字体样式:
font-family、font-size、font-weight等 - 文字样式:
color、text-decoration、text-align等 - 背景样式:
background-color、background-image等 - 边框样式:
border、border-radius等 - 盒模型样式:
width、height、margin、padding等
三、JavaScript
JavaScript是一种脚本语言,用于实现网页的动态交互和数据处理。通过使用JavaScript语句和API,可以操作网页中的元素、处理表单数据、发送请求等。
JavaScript包含以下常用技术:
- DOM操作:通过获取DOM元素并修改其属性或样式,实现网页的动态变化。
- 事件处理:通过添加事件监听器,响应用户的交互行为,如点击、滚动、键盘输入等。
- AJAX:通过XMLHttpRequest对象或fetch函数,向服务器发送异步请求,获取数据并更新网页内容。
- 表单验证:通过正则表达式或内置函数,对用户输入的内容进行验证和处理。
- 动画效果:通过修改元素的样式属性或使用CSS动画库,实现网页的动态效果。
以上是Web前端开发中常用的技术和工具。除了这些,还有许多前端框架(如React、Vue、Angular)和工具(如Sass、Less、Webpack)可供开发人员选择和使用。对于Web前端开发人员来说,除了掌握这些技术和工具,还需要具备良好的团队合作和问题解决能力,不断学习和更新自己的知识。
1年前 - 标题标签: